Religious accommodations policy (Florida)

A religious accommodations policy helps Florida businesses establish guidelines for supporting employees who have religious beliefs and practices. This policy outlines procedures for requesting, evaluating, and implementing accommodations to ensure that employees can observe their religious practices without undue hardship. It is designed to promote inclusivity, reduce barriers, and provide clear expectations for managing religious accommodations in the workplace.

By implementing this policy, businesses in Florida can demonstrate their commitment to inclusivity, enhance employee satisfaction, and align with the state’s focus on diversity and mutual respect.

How to use this religious accommodations policy (Florida)

  • Define eligible requests: Clearly specify what constitutes a request for religious accommodation, such as time off for religious observances, dress code modifications, or prayer breaks.
  • Establish request procedures: Outline how employees should submit accommodation requests, including whom to contact and how to document requests.
  • Address evaluation criteria: Explain how businesses should assess requests based on factors such as job requirements, feasibility, and operational impact.
  • Provide support resources: Offer information about employee assistance programs (EAPs) or local resources for support.
  • Communicate the policy: Share the policy with employees during onboarding and through regular communications to ensure awareness and understanding.
  • Monitor adherence: Regularly review how the policy is applied and address any concerns or discrepancies promptly.
  • Update the policy: Periodically assess the policy to reflect changes in workplace dynamics, legal standards, or business needs.
